NOVELTY - The sensor has a graphene conductor portion fixed on an upper side of a substrate. A nano-wire light-collecting portion is fixed on upper part of the graphene conductor portion to absorb light energy. A metal electrode is connected to two sides of the graphene conductor portion that is provided with a graphene layer. USE - Graphene-nanowire hybird structure optical sensor. ADVANTAGE - The sensor ensures quick optical response speed, and is convenient to use.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is also included for a method for manufacturing an optical sensor.
